Luana Lionetto is a scholar working on Psychiatry and Mental health, Pathology and Forensic Medicine and Physi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Luana Lionetto has authored 102 papers receiving a total of 2.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 49 papers in Psychiatry and Mental health, 26 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ine and 23 papers in Physiology. Recurrent topics in Luana Lionetto’s work include Migraine and Headache Studies (32 papers), Tryptophan and brain disorders (18 papers) and Trigeminal Neuralgia and Treatments (17 papers). Luana Lionetto is often cited by papers focused on Migraine and Headache Studies (32 papers), Tryptophan and brain disorders (18 papers) and Trigeminal Neuralgia and Treatments (17 papers). Luana Lionetto coll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United States and Spain. Luana Lionetto's co-authors include Maurizio Simmaco, Paolo Martelletti, Martina Curto, Andrea Negro, Ferdinando Nicoletti, Matilde Capi, Giovanna Gentile, Francesco Fazio, Marina Borro and Giuseppe Battaglia and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, PLoS ONE and Cancer Research.
